www.vishay.com Not for New Designs 516D Vishay Sprague Aluminum Capacitors +85 °C, Miniature, Axial Lead FEATURES • High CV per case size • Material categorization: for definitions of compliance please see www.vishay.com/doc?99912 QUICK REFERENCE DATA DESCRIPTION VALUE Nominal case size Ø D x L in mm 0.197" x 0.472" [5.0 x 12.0] to 0.709" x 1.614" [18.0 x 41.0] Operating temperature Rated capacitance range, CR Tolerance on CR Rated voltage range, UR Termination -40 °C to +85 °C (-25 °C to +85 °C for 315 WVDC to 450 WVDC units) 0.47 μF to 10 000 μF ± 20 % 6.3 WVDC to 450 WVDC 2 axial leads Life validation test at 85 °C 2000 h: ΔCAP ≤ 20 % from initial measurement. ΔDF x 2 initial specified limit. ΔDCL ≤ initial specified limit. Shelf life at 85 °C 1000 h: ΔCAP ± 20 % from initial measurement. ΔDF 2 x initial specified limit. ΔDCL ≤ the initial specified limit. DC leakage current Rated voltage for 1 min for 6.3 WVDC to 100 WVDC units I < 0.03 CV or 4 μA (whichever is greater) Rated voltage for 2 min for 6.3 WVDC to 100 WVDC units I < 0.01 CV or 3 μA (whichever is greater) Rated voltage for 1 min for 160 WVDC to 450 WVDC units I < 0.1 CV + 40 μA and CV ≤ 1000 I < 0.04 CV + 100 μA and CV > 1000 RIPPLE CURRENT MULTIPLIERS TEMPERATURE AMBIENT TEMPERATURE MULTIPLIERS ≤ +70 °C 1.27 +85 °C 1.0 FREQUENCY (Hz) / CAPACITANCE (μF) WVDC CAP.
